The Power Of Medical Device Animation

medical device animation is a powerful tool that can revolutionize the way healthcare professionals and patients understand complex medical devices and procedures. These animations provide a detailed and interactive visualization of various medical devices, their functionality, and the procedures involved in using them. From surgical tools to implantable devices, medical device animation offers a clear and comprehensive representation that can help bridge the gap between technical concepts and layman understanding.

One of the key advantages of medical device animation is its ability to simplify complex medical information. Many medical devices operate using intricate mechanisms that can be difficult to grasp without a visual aid. By using animation, healthcare professionals can easily explain how a particular medical device works, its benefits, and how it can improve patient outcomes. This can be especially useful in educating patients about the devices that will be used as part of their treatment plan, helping them make more informed decisions about their healthcare.

Furthermore, medical device animation can also be used in medical training and education. Whether it’s teaching medical students about the latest surgical tools or training healthcare professionals on the proper use of a new medical device, animations provide a dynamic and interactive way to convey important information. By creating realistic and detailed animations, trainees can gain a better understanding of how a medical device functions and how it should be operated in various clinical scenarios. This can ultimately lead to improved patient care and better treatment outcomes.

Moreover, medical device animation can also be used in patient education and engagement. Many patients may feel intimidated or confused by the prospect of undergoing a medical procedure involving a particular device. By utilizing animations, healthcare providers can visually demonstrate the steps involved in using the device, the potential risks and benefits, and what to expect during and after the procedure. This can help alleviate patient anxiety, improve compliance with treatment plans, and enhance overall patient satisfaction.

In addition, medical device animation can be a valuable tool for medical device companies looking to showcase their products to potential clients and investors. By creating visually stunning and informative animations, companies can effectively communicate the unique features and benefits of their devices, as well as demonstrate how they can address specific medical needs or challenges. This can be particularly useful in the design and development stages of a new medical device, allowing engineers and designers to visualize how the device will function and interact with the human body.
